Paul Knobloch
Paul Knobloch is an Australian choreographer, creative director, and ballet répétiteur, acclaimed for his mastery of ballet, contemporary dance, and theatre. His diverse portfolio includes contributions to stage, film, and television.
An honours graduate of The Australian Ballet School, he joined The Australian Ballet in 2002, swiftly rising to soloist before embarking on an international career. In 2009, he became a Principal Dancer with Béjart Ballet Lausanne and has performed worldwide with notable companies including English National Ballet, Alonzo King LINES Ballet, West Australian Ballet, and Sydney Dance Company. His repertoire spans a wide range of principal roles in the classical canon, earning him the admiration of leading choreographers who have commissioned him to create numerous original works. As a choreographer, Knobloch is recognised for seamlessly blending classical and contemporary styles, and for performances noted for their dynamic visual impact. His innovative vision has led to commissions for The Australian Ballet, Queensland Ballet, Singapore Ballet, Ballet Theatre Malaysia, and Ballet Victoria Canada, as well as for schools, festivals, and institutions across Australia, Canada, and the USA.
Knobloch is esteemed as a mentor, educator, and coach. He has served as a guest teacher with Les Ballets de Monte Carlo, Tokyo Ballet, Hong Kong Ballet, St Petersburg Ballet, and numerous leading schools. Honoured in 2001 as ACT Young Australian of the Year, he has a string of accolades to his name. He currently works as a freelance choreographer and répétiteur for The Australian Ballet, its national tour, and Storytime Ballet.
